  • Toy device where trolley with wings flies up a kite string, then folds its wings at the top and releases cargo
  • Tech class; CPC A63H27/087: Means for launching objects along the kite string, e.g. with parachutes
  • Inventor location: Jacksonville, Morgan county, IL (FIPSloc=17137, imputed by HistPat)
